I say priceless because it once belonged to my great grandpa. he bought it new years ago. I would like to know what year and maybe some of you guys might know how I could find out just how old it is.
it is a Sears, Roebuck and Co. side by side 20ga. it is a Laurona-Eibar (Espana) made in spain. [img] [/img] [img] [/img] [img] [/img] he gave it to me about 25 years ago a year or two before he died. he took great care of it and I have as well. it is a sharp looking gun with lots of engraving on it. how can I tell how old it is?

I see quite a few Spnaish side by sides for sale by a seller who specializes in curio & relic firearms. Most of them date from the 40s to 50s. I have a 22 that belong to my Grandfather as well, book value around $300. To me it is priceless and will never be sold.
